Two young migrants once met in a London Laundromat and thus begins Mariam Crichton's fascinating tale. This episode of Gone Workabout traces her life growing up in a Housing estate through to CEO and plenty along the way.
Mariam is an energetic, outspoken and yet humble tech leader, based in Brighton, UK. She is a Non-Executive Director of Wired Sussex, a mum of one, Speaks widely on issues of Leadership in Technology and likes to paint in her spare time.
